Who funds Smithsonian Institution?
Smithsonian Institution is funded by 161 grantmakers, led by Lilly Endowment Inc ($57.1M), Gordon E and Betty I Moore Foundation ($16.4M), The Andrew W Mellon Foundation ($6.2M). In total, IRS Form 990 filings record $103.6M in grants to Smithsonian Institution between 2024–2025.
